The Pioneer with "MCACC" unfortunately was still in its box. The Panasonic had just come out of its cardboard shipping device--it was still on the floor. It was the XR-SA25 (I think that's the correct letters) and it was priced at $299.99.

Looks: if you've seen the DVD-S35 dvd player, then you have (almost) seen this receiver. Except it's bottom half is black and its deeper. Remote: same but bigger. Receiver has 5" wide X 1/16" lighted blue strip in the middle. Dimmer button turns it off. Some chrome buttons & volume knob. Very minimalist front--but not cheap looking or anything.

Features: from reading the front panel, it's got DTS-ES/Neo:6 & DPL II.

Has 6-channel digital amp & no ventilation slots on top either.
